Searched refs:nir_if (Results 1 - 25 of 132) sorted by relevance

123456

/xsrc/external/mit/MesaLib.old/dist/src/compiler/nir/tests/
H A Dcomparison_pre_tests.cpp97 nir_if *nif = nir_push_if(&bld, flt);
149 nir_if *nif = nir_push_if(&bld, flt);
202 nir_if *nif = nir_push_if(&bld, flt);
254 nir_if *nif = nir_push_if(&bld, flt);
307 nir_if *nif = nir_push_if(&bld, flt);
360 nir_if *nif = nir_push_if(&bld, flt);
414 nir_if *nif = nir_push_if(&bld, flt);
467 nir_if *nif = nir_push_if(&bld, flt);
513 nir_if *nif = nir_push_if(&bld, &flt->dest.dest.ssa);
/xsrc/external/mit/MesaLib/dist/src/compiler/nir/
H A Dnir_loop_analyze.h51 nir_if *if_stmt = nir_cf_node_as_if(node);
80 nir_is_trivial_loop_if(nir_if *nif, nir_block *break_block)
H A Dnir_opt_trivial_continues.c44 nir_if *prev_if = nir_cf_node_as_if(prev_node);
86 nir_if *nif = nir_cf_node_as_if(cf_node);
H A Dnir_opt_if.c159 nir_if *nif = nir_cf_node_as_if(if_node);
776 nir_if *nif = NULL;
841 rewrite_phi_predecessor_blocks(nir_if *nif,
882 opt_if_simplification(nir_builder *b, nir_if *nif)
955 opt_if_loop_terminator(nir_if *nif)
1006 evaluate_if_condition(nir_if *nif, nir_cursor cursor, bool *value)
1096 propagate_condition_eval(nir_builder *b, nir_if *nif, nir_src *use_src,
1148 evaluate_condition_use(nir_builder *b, nir_if *nif, nir_src *use_src,
1185 opt_if_evaluate_condition_use(nir_builder *b, nir_if *nif)
1204 rewrite_comp_uses_within_if(nir_builder *b, nir_if *ni
[all...]
H A Dnir_opt_move.c109 nir_if *iff = nir_block_get_following_if(block);
H A Dnir_opt_dead_cf.c84 opt_constant_if(nir_if *if_stmt, bool condition)
287 nir_if *following_if = nir_block_get_following_if(block);
351 nir_if *if_stmt = nir_cf_node_as_if(cur);
H A Dnir_control_flow.c108 nir_if *if_stmt = nir_cf_node_as_if(node);
136 nir_if *if_stmt = nir_cf_node_as_if(node);
302 nir_if *next_if = nir_cf_node_as_if(next);
534 nir_if *if_stmt = nir_cf_node_as_if(node);
643 nir_if *if_stmt = nir_cf_node_as_if(node);
756 nir_if *if_stmt = nir_cf_node_as_if(node);
H A Dnir_liveness.c183 nir_if *following_if = nir_block_get_following_if(block);
294 nir_if *following_if = nir_block_get_following_if(start->block);
400 nir_if *nif = nir_block_get_following_if(block);
H A Dnir_opt_peephole_select.c270 nir_opt_collapse_if(nir_if *if_stmt, nir_shader *shader, unsigned limit,
277 nir_if *parent_if = nir_cf_node_as_if(if_stmt->cf_node.parent);
395 nir_if *if_stmt = nir_cf_node_as_if(prev_node);
H A Dnir_opt_conditional_discard.c45 nir_if *if_stmt = nir_cf_node_as_if(prev_node);
H A Dnir_opt_rematerialize_compares.c152 nir_if *const if_stmt = use->parent_if;
/xsrc/external/mit/MesaLib.old/dist/src/compiler/nir/
H A Dnir_loop_analyze.h51 nir_if *if_stmt = nir_cf_node_as_if(node);
79 nir_is_trivial_loop_if(nir_if *nif, nir_block *break_block)
H A Dnir_opt_trivial_continues.c44 nir_if *prev_if = nir_cf_node_as_if(prev_node);
86 nir_if *nif = nir_cf_node_as_if(cf_node);
H A Dnir_opt_move_comparisons.c107 nir_if *iff = nir_block_get_following_if(block);
H A Dnir_opt_move_load_ubo.c74 nir_if *iff = nir_block_get_following_if(block);
H A Dnir_opt_if.c161 nir_if *nif = nir_cf_node_as_if(if_node);
841 nir_if *nif;
906 rewrite_phi_predecessor_blocks(nir_if *nif,
947 opt_if_simplification(nir_builder *b, nir_if *nif)
1009 opt_if_loop_terminator(nir_if *nif)
1060 evaluate_if_condition(nir_if *nif, nir_cursor cursor, bool *value)
1150 propagate_condition_eval(nir_builder *b, nir_if *nif, nir_src *use_src,
1202 evaluate_condition_use(nir_builder *b, nir_if *nif, nir_src *use_src,
1239 opt_if_evaluate_condition_use(nir_builder *b, nir_if *nif)
1258 simple_merge_if(nir_if *dest_i
[all...]
H A Dnir_opt_conditional_discard.c42 nir_if *if_stmt = nir_cf_node_as_if(prev_node);
H A Dnir_opt_copy_propagate.c100 copy_prop_src(nir_src *src, nir_instr *parent_instr, nir_if *parent_if,
255 copy_prop_if(nir_if *if_stmt)
271 nir_if *if_stmt = nir_block_get_following_if(block);
H A Dnir_opt_dead_cf.c84 opt_constant_if(nir_if *if_stmt, bool condition)
250 nir_if *following_if = nir_block_get_following_if(block);
314 nir_if *if_stmt = nir_cf_node_as_if(cur);
H A Dnir_opt_dce.c113 nir_if *following_if = nir_block_get_following_if(block);
/xsrc/external/mit/MesaLib/dist/src/compiler/nir/tests/
H A Dcomparison_pre_tests.cpp101 nir_if *nif = nir_push_if(&bld, flt);
153 nir_if *nif = nir_push_if(&bld, flt);
206 nir_if *nif = nir_push_if(&bld, flt);
258 nir_if *nif = nir_push_if(&bld, flt);
311 nir_if *nif = nir_push_if(&bld, flt);
364 nir_if *nif = nir_push_if(&bld, flt);
418 nir_if *nif = nir_push_if(&bld, flt);
471 nir_if *nif = nir_push_if(&bld, flt);
510 nir_if *nif = nir_push_if(&bld, &flt->dest.dest.ssa);
567 nir_if *ni
[all...]
H A Dopt_if_tests.cpp73 nir_if *nif = nir_push_if(&bld, cmp_result);
110 nir_if *nif = nir_push_if(&bld, cmp_result);
/xsrc/external/mit/MesaLib/dist/src/gallium/drivers/r600/sfn/
H A Dsfn_nir_legalize_image_load_store.cpp52 nir_if *if_exists = nir_push_if(b, image_exists);
54 nir_if *load_if = nullptr;
119 nir_if *load_else = nir_push_else(b, load_if);
129 nir_if *else_exists = nir_push_else(b, if_exists);
/xsrc/external/mit/MesaLib/dist/src/gallium/drivers/d3d12/
H A Dd3d12_lower_int_cubemap_to_array.c168 nir_if *use_face_x_if = nir_push_if(b, use_face_x);
170 nir_if *use_face_x_else = nir_push_else(b, use_face_x_if);
176 nir_if *use_face_y_if = nir_push_if(b, use_face_y);
178 nir_if *use_face_y_else = nir_push_else(b, use_face_y_if);
/xsrc/external/mit/MesaLib.old/dist/src/intel/compiler/
H A Dbrw_nir_analyze_boolean_resolves.c247 nir_if *following_if = nir_block_get_following_if(block);

Completed in 19 milliseconds

123456